John Lloyd Wright, the son of architect Frank Lloyd Wright, first developed the concept for Lincoln Logs in 1916. By the 1920s, the younger Wright had patented his stackable wooden construction sets and named them after the Kentucky log cabin where America's 16th President, Abraham Lincoln, was born.
Born in 1892, John Kenneth (later changed to Lloyd) Wright was the second of Frank and Catherine Wright's six children. John's early years in Oak Park, Illinois, seemed happy; he reminisced about the fun times spent in the playroom of his childhood house—designed by his father, of course—and the lively parties hosted by his parents.
John Lloyd Wright (December 12, 1892 - December 20, 1972) was an American architect and toy inventor. Born in Oak Park, Illinois, Wright was the second-oldest son of famed architect Frank Lloyd Wright. John Lloyd Wright became estranged from his father in 1909 and subsequently left his home to join his brother on the West Coast.
